At its core, blockchain provides a secure and transparent ledger that records transactions across a network of computers. This distributed nature eliminates the need for intermediaries, fostering direct peer-to-peer interactions and creating new opportunities for value creation and capture. This is where the concept of "tokenomics" comes into play – the design and application of economic incentives within a blockchain ecosystem. Tokens, which are digital assets built on a blockchain, can represent a wide array of things: utility, ownership, voting rights, or even a share in future profits. The way these tokens are designed, distributed, and utilized directly influences the revenue-generating potential of a blockchain project.

One of the most straightforward yet powerful blockchain revenue models is transaction fees. In many public blockchains like Ethereum, users pay a small fee, often in the native cryptocurrency (like Ether), to process their transactions and execute smart contracts. This fee compensates the network's validators or miners for their computational work and secures the network. For projects built on these blockchains, these transaction fees can become a significant source of revenue. Imagine a decentralized exchange (DEX) where every trade incurs a small fee, or a decentralized application (dApp) that charges a fee for accessing its services. The scale of these fees, when aggregated across millions of users and billions of transactions, can be substantial, creating a self-sustaining economic loop for the platform.

Beyond simple transaction fees, utility tokens represent a broad category of revenue models. These tokens grant holders access to specific services or functionalities within a particular blockchain ecosystem. For instance, a decentralized storage network might issue a utility token that users must hold or spend to store their data. The demand for data storage directly drives the demand for the token, increasing its value and providing revenue to the network operators or token holders. Similarly, a decentralized content platform could use a utility token for users to unlock premium content, boost their posts, or even pay creators. This model aligns the interests of users and the platform: as the platform grows and offers more value, the utility token becomes more desirable, rewarding early adopters and investors.

Decentralized Autonomous Organizations (DAOs) are ushering in a new era of governance and revenue generation. DAOs are organizations whose rules are encoded as a computer program, are transparent, controlled by the organization members, and not influenced by a central government. Revenue within a DAO can be generated through various means, such as charging for membership, offering premium services, or investing treasury funds. Crucially, token holders in a DAO often have voting rights, influencing the direction of the organization and its revenue-generating strategies. This collective ownership and decision-making can lead to highly innovative and community-driven revenue models that adapt to the evolving needs of their users. For example, a DAO focused on funding public goods could generate revenue through grants and then distribute those funds based on community proposals, creating a virtuous cycle of innovation and investment.

Decentralized Finance (DeFi), a burgeoning sector within blockchain, has introduced a plethora of revenue models. DeFi platforms aim to recreate traditional financial services like lending, borrowing, and trading without relying on centralized institutions. Lending protocols generate revenue by facilitating loans and earning a spread between the interest paid by borrowers and the interest paid to lenders. Decentralized exchanges (DEXs) earn trading fees from users swapping one cryptocurrency for another. Yield farming protocols incentivize users to provide liquidity to DeFi platforms by offering rewards in native tokens, which can then be sold for revenue. These models are disruptive because they often offer higher returns and lower fees than their centralized counterparts, driven by efficiency and competition within the decentralized ecosystem. The smart contracts governing these protocols automate complex financial operations, reducing operational costs and increasing accessibility.

The emergence of Non-Fungible Tokens (NFTs) has opened up entirely new avenues for revenue, extending far beyond digital art. NFTs are unique digital assets that represent ownership of a specific item, whether it's a piece of art, a virtual collectible, a piece of music, or even real-world assets like real estate. Creators can sell NFTs directly to their audience, bypassing traditional intermediaries and retaining a larger share of the revenue. Furthermore, smart contracts can be programmed to give creators a percentage of all future resale transactions of their NFTs. This "creator royalty" model ensures that artists and innovators are continuously compensated for their work as its value appreciates over time. Beyond direct sales, NFTs can be used to represent ownership in fractionalized assets, opening up investment opportunities in high-value items that were previously inaccessible to the average person. The revenue generated here comes from primary sales, secondary market royalties, and potentially from fees associated with managing and verifying ownership of these unique digital assets. The flexibility of NFTs means their application in revenue generation is still being explored, with potential for gaming, ticketing, intellectual property rights, and more.

The concept of fractional ownership of assets is another area where blockchain is unlocking new revenue streams. Traditionally, high-value assets like real estate, fine art, or even intellectual property were only accessible to a select few. By tokenizing these assets, they can be divided into smaller, more manageable units represented by unique tokens on a blockchain. This allows a wider range of investors to participate, democratizing access to investments and increasing liquidity. Revenue can be generated through the initial token issuance (akin to selling shares), ongoing management fees for the tokenized asset, and potentially through transaction fees on secondary market trading of these tokens. For instance, a property developer could tokenize a new building, selling fractional ownership to numerous investors, thereby securing funding for the project while creating an ongoing revenue stream from management and trading fees.

Decentralized data storage and cloud services are evolving beyond simple utility tokens. Projects like Filecoin and Arweave are building entire economies around decentralized infrastructure. Users pay to store data, and those who provide storage space earn tokens. The revenue models are multifaceted: transaction fees for data retrieval, fees for the network's computational resources, and potentially a portion of the value generated from the data itself if it's made accessible and monetizable with user consent. This model directly challenges the dominance of centralized cloud providers like Amazon Web Services (AWS) and Microsoft Azure by offering a more resilient, censorship-resistant, and potentially more cost-effective alternative. The revenue is generated by the ongoing demand for secure and accessible data storage and processing power within a decentralized network.

The gaming industry is ripe for blockchain-driven revenue innovation, particularly through play-to-earn (P2E) models and in-game asset ownership. By integrating NFTs and cryptocurrencies into games, developers can create economies where players can earn real-world value by playing. Players can acquire unique in-game assets (as NFTs), which they can then trade, sell, or rent to other players. Developers earn revenue through initial game sales, transaction fees on in-game marketplaces, and potentially through selling premium in-game items that enhance the player experience. This model fosters a more engaged player base, as their time and effort invested in the game can translate into tangible economic benefits. Furthermore, the ownership of in-game assets by players creates a secondary market that can drive ongoing engagement and value creation, benefiting both players and developers.

Blockchain-as-a-Service (BaaS) providers are emerging as key players in enabling traditional businesses to adopt blockchain technology without needing deep technical expertise. These providers offer cloud-based solutions that allow companies to build, deploy, and manage their own private or consortium blockchains. Revenue is generated through subscription fees, usage-based pricing for network resources, consulting services for implementation, and specialized development support. BaaS platforms abstract away the complexity of blockchain infrastructure, making it accessible for a wider range of enterprises looking to leverage features like supply chain tracking, secure data sharing, or digital asset management. This model taps into the growing demand for enterprise-grade blockchain solutions.

One of the most direct paths to realizing profits from digital assets is through investment and trading. For cryptocurrencies, this can involve active trading, aiming to profit from short-term price fluctuations, or long-term holding (HODLing), betting on the sustained growth of specific digital currencies. The key here lies in thorough research. Understanding the whitepaper of a cryptocurrency project, its team, its technological innovation, its tokenomics (how the token is distributed and managed), and its competitive landscape is vital. Similarly, in the NFT space, identifying projects with strong artistic merit, a dedicated community, a clear roadmap, and utility beyond mere speculation is crucial. Investing in NFTs that are part of a larger ecosystem, such as those tied to gaming or the metaverse, can offer more sustainable value. Diversification, a cornerstone of traditional investing, also applies here. Spreading investments across different types of digital assets and projects can help mitigate risk.

Beyond speculative trading, income generation through digital assets offers a more passive yet potentially lucrative approach. Staking cryptocurrencies is a prime example. By locking up certain cryptocurrencies, users contribute to the security and operational efficiency of their respective blockchain networks. In return, they are rewarded with additional tokens. The Annual Percentage Yields (APYs) for staking can often be significantly higher than those offered by traditional financial institutions, though they are also subject to the volatility of the underlying asset. Similarly, yield farming and liquidity provision in Decentralized Finance (DeFi) protocols allow users to earn rewards by depositing their digital assets into lending pools or trading pairs. This is essentially providing the capital that powers DeFi applications, and in exchange, users receive a share of the transaction fees or new tokens. These methods require a deeper technical understanding of DeFi protocols and the associated risks, such as smart contract vulnerabilities and impermanent loss, but they unlock sophisticated ways to generate returns from digital holdings.
